Rishon Le’Zion, Israel and New York, New York, June 13,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Holisto Ltd, a technology based online travel booking platform (“Holisto” or the “Company”), and Moringa Acquisition Corp (Nasdaq: MACA, “Moringa”), a special purpose acquisition company, today announced they have entered into a business combination agreement that would result in Holisto becoming publicly listed on the Nasdaq. The business combination provides for Holisto Ltd.’s expected pro forma equity value to be approximately $405 million. As described below and subject to certain limitations, the transaction provides Moringa’s non-redeeming public shareholders the opportunity to receive a pro rata portion of a bonus pool of up to an additional 1,725,000 shares at transaction close, which would result in merger consideration of between 1.15 and 1.6 Holisto ordinary shares for each such Moringa Class A ordinary share not redeemed. The exact ratio of merger consideration for non-redeeming shareholders will depend on the number of Moringa shares that are redeemed.

The closing of the transaction is expected to occur during the fourth quarter of 2022.

Holisto is a technology-based online travel booking platform that is disrupting the market by harnessing the power of advanced AI to make travel more affordable and personalized for consumers. Holisto’s advanced AI technology leverages its unique holistic view of hotel rates and plans across multiple inventory sources, including online travel agencies, global distribution systems, wholesalers and hotel operators to provide consumers with more affordable and personalized bookings. Key Transaction Terms

Holisto’s expected implied pro forma equity value is approximately $405 million, based on a $10 share price. However, a bonus pool of up to an additional 1,725,000 Holisto shares will be distributed to non-redeeming Moringa shareholders on a pro rata basis, which will result in an exchange ratio in the business combination of between 1.15 and 1.6 Holisto ordinary shares for each unredeemed Moringa Class A ordinary share, with the exact ratio to be determined based on the number of Moringa public shares being redeemed. Assuming a price of $10.00 per Moringa Class A ordinary share at the closing of the transaction, non-redeeming Moringa shareholders would receive, in exchange for each Moringa Class A ordinary share held, shares of the post-combination public company with a value equating to between $11.50 (assuming no redemptions by Moringa shareholders) and $16.00 (assuming at least 75% redemptions, resulting in the maximum share ratio).

Contemporaneously with the execution of the business combination agreement, Moringa and Holisto entered into a securities purchase agreement with a non-affiliated investor pursuant to which the investor would purchase a $30 million senior secured convertible note from Holisto, which would be convertible into Holisto ordinary shares at the lesser of $11.00 per share or 90% of the market price at the time of conversion, and a warrant to purchase 1,363,636 Holisto ordinary shares at an exercise price of $11.50. The convertible note financing is subject to closing conditions of both Holisto and the note investor.

The business combination, which has been unanimously approved by the boards of directors of Holisto and Moringa, is expected to close in the fourth quarter of 2022, subject to the satisfaction of customary closing conditions, including the approval of Holisto and Moringa shareholders and Nasdaq approval.

About Holisto

Holisto is a tech-powered online travel agency, aiming to make hotel booking affordable and personalized for consumers. The company, founded in 2015, spent over 6 years developing award-winning AI and machine learning technologies, to provide consumers with more affordable and personalized hotel bookings, that otherwise aren’t accessible. Instead of simply searching and comparing available deals as offered by the various industry channels, Holisto deploys predictive proprietary algorithms, allowing it to create in real-time, unique booking options based on travelers’ preferences.  Company brands include GoSplitty.com and Traveluro.
